当前位置:首页 > 综合资讯 > 正文
黑狐家游戏

本地数据库上传到云服务器数据库笔记,本地数据库上传至云服务器数据库的详细步骤及注意事项

本地数据库上传到云服务器数据库笔记,本地数据库上传至云服务器数据库的详细步骤及注意事项

将本地数据库上传至云服务器数据库,需先备份本地数据库,通过FTP或数据库迁移工具上传至云服务器,然后在服务器上创建数据库,导入数据,注意选择合适的迁移工具,确保数据完整...

将本地数据库上传至云服务器数据库,需先备份本地数据库,通过FTP或数据库迁移工具上传至云服务器,然后在服务器上创建数据库,导入数据,注意选择合适的迁移工具,确保数据完整性和安全性,并在上传前后检查数据库连接和权限设置。

随着互联网技术的不断发展,越来越多的企业和个人开始使用云服务器来存储和管理数据,将本地数据库上传到云服务器数据库,不仅可以提高数据的安全性,还可以实现数据的远程访问和共享,本文将详细介绍如何将本地数据库上传至云服务器数据库,并分享一些注意事项。

准备工作

本地数据库上传到云服务器数据库笔记,本地数据库上传至云服务器数据库的详细步骤及注意事项

图片来源于网络,如有侵权联系删除

  1. 云服务器:选择一家可靠的云服务提供商,如阿里云、腾讯云等,购买一台云服务器。

  2. 数据库软件:确保本地数据库和云服务器数据库软件版本兼容,如MySQL、Oracle等。

  3. 数据库备份:在将本地数据库上传至云服务器之前,请先对本地数据库进行备份,以防数据丢失。

  4. 数据库连接工具:如Navicat、phpMyAdmin等,用于连接和管理数据库。

上传步骤

登录云服务器

使用SSH或远程桌面工具登录云服务器,确保服务器环境正常运行。

安装数据库软件

根据云服务器操作系统,安装相应的数据库软件,以下以MySQL为例:

# 安装MySQL
sudo apt-get update
sudo apt-get install mysql-server

创建数据库用户和权限

登录MySQL数据库,创建一个新用户,并授权该用户对数据库进行操作。

# 登录MySQL
mysql -u root -p
# 创建用户
CREATE USER 'username'@'localhost' IDENTIFIED BY 'password';
# 授权用户
GRANT ALL PRIVILEGES ON *.* TO 'username'@'localhost';
# 刷新权限
FLUSH PRIVILEGES;
# 退出MySQL
EXIT;

上传数据库文件

将本地数据库文件上传至云服务器,以下以使用SCP命令为例:

本地数据库上传到云服务器数据库笔记,本地数据库上传至云服务器数据库的详细步骤及注意事项

图片来源于网络,如有侵权联系删除

# 上传数据库文件
scp /path/to/local/database.sql username@your_server_ip:/path/to/remote_directory

导入数据库

在云服务器上,使用数据库连接工具连接到MySQL数据库,并导入上传的数据库文件。

# 导入数据库
mysql -u username -p database_name < /path/to/remote_directory/database.sql

验证数据库

登录云服务器数据库,验证数据是否已成功上传。

# 登录MySQL
mysql -u username -p
# 查询数据
SELECT * FROM table_name;

注意事项

  1. 数据库备份:在操作过程中,请确保本地数据库已备份,以防数据丢失。

  2. 数据库版本兼容:确保本地数据库和云服务器数据库软件版本兼容,避免出现兼容性问题。

  3. 数据库用户权限:合理设置数据库用户权限,防止数据泄露。

  4. 数据传输安全:在传输数据库文件时,请使用安全的传输方式,如SCP、SFTP等。

  5. 数据库性能优化:上传完成后,对云服务器数据库进行性能优化,提高数据库运行效率。

  6. 定期备份:定期备份云服务器数据库,确保数据安全。

将本地数据库上传至云服务器数据库,可以方便地实现数据的远程访问和共享,本文详细介绍了上传步骤和注意事项,希望对您有所帮助,在实际操作过程中,请根据实际情况进行调整。

黑狐家游戏

发表评论

最新文章